The short answer

Braum's averages 93.6/100 across the 18 of 63 tracked products that carry an ingredient list, and 50.0% of those contain at least one separately flagged ingredient. The figure summarizes Open Food Facts labels cross-referenced with FDA SAFFA and CSPI; it does not establish recall status, allergy suitability, or the composition of products outside this snapshot.

Catalog evidence

Ingredient-list coverage comes before the score

Only 18 of 63 tracked Braum's records (28.6%) include an ingredient list. The remaining 45 cannot be screened, so the 93.6/100 mean describes the labelled subset rather than the whole brand.

Processing mix (NOVA)

Braum's processing intensity

Braum's's NOVA-classified set is 14 products: 85.7% ultra-processed (Group 4, 12 items) with Group 4 (ultra-processed) largest at 12. That ultra-processed share sits 7.4 points above the 78.3% median for 1,323 brands with 50+ products. NOVA is processing intensity, not additive safety.

Braum's relies most on Carrageenan, an industry staple

Across the 18 Braum's products scored here, Carrageenan appears in 8. It is used by 2,390 other brands in this database (6.8% of them), so its presence says more about the category than about this brand. A flag records that a named source raised a concern about an ingredient. It is not a finding that a product is unsafe to eat.

Flagged ingredientBraum's productsWhy it is flagged
Carrageenan8Concern recorded by a review body; no ban cited
Acesulfame Potassium1Concern recorded by a review body; no ban cited
Azodicarbonamide1Restricted: EU (banned); Australia (banned)
Caramel Coloring1Restricted: California (Prop 65 warning for 4-MEI)
Red 401FDA voluntary phase-out target 2027-12-31 (a request, not a ban) · Restricted: California (schools)
Sucralose1Concern recorded by a review body; no ban cited

Counts are products in this database whose ingredient list names the flagged ingredient. Flags come from FDA enforcement actions, CSPI Chemical Cuisine ratings and US state ingredient laws; see the methodology for how each source is applied.
